In the world of manufacturing and production, various methods are employed to optimize efficiency and output. One such method that has gained considerable attention is the batch method. The batch method refers to a production process where goods are produced in groups or batches rather than in a continuous stream. This technique is particularly useful in industries where products are customized or require different processes at various stages of production.The advantages of the batch method are manifold. Firstly, it allows for greater flexibility in production. Manufacturers can easily switch from one product type to another without significant downtime. For instance, a bakery may use the batch method to produce different types of bread or pastries in separate batches, ensuring that each product meets specific quality standards without compromising the entire production line.Moreover, the batch method can lead to cost savings. By producing items in batches, companies can take advantage of economies of scale, reducing the cost per unit. This is particularly beneficial for businesses that operate on tight margins, as it enables them to maximize their profits while maintaining quality. Additionally, the batch method allows for better inventory management; manufacturers can produce only what is needed, minimizing waste and storage costs.However, there are also challenges associated with the batch method. One significant drawback is the potential for inefficiencies during the transition between batches. Changing from one product to another may require retooling machinery, cleaning equipment, or adjusting workflows, which can lead to increased downtime. This transition period can affect overall productivity and may require careful planning and scheduling to mitigate its impact.Another challenge is the risk of overproduction. If demand forecasts are inaccurate, manufacturers may end up producing more than what is needed, leading to excess inventory. This situation can tie up capital and resources that could be better utilized elsewhere. Therefore, accurate forecasting and demand analysis are crucial when employing the batch method.Despite these challenges, the batch method remains a popular choice for many industries, including food production, pharmaceuticals, and textiles. Its ability to adapt to varying production needs makes it an attractive option for businesses seeking to balance quality, cost, and efficiency. Furthermore, advancements in technology, such as automation and data analytics, have enhanced the effectiveness of the batch method, allowing manufacturers to streamline processes and reduce transition times.In conclusion, the batch method plays a vital role in modern manufacturing. By producing goods in batches, companies can achieve greater flexibility, cost savings, and improved inventory management. While there are challenges to consider, the benefits often outweigh the drawbacks, making the batch method a valuable strategy for businesses aiming to thrive in a competitive market. As industries continue to evolve, the batch method will likely remain a cornerstone of production practices, adapting to meet the demands of consumers and the marketplace.
